Jesus Feeds 5,000
Jesus and the disciples continue to walk the countryside. And a great crowd follows them. Peter comes and asks Jesus to send the people away. He wants them to find food and a place to stay with local farmers and villagers. Jesus looks back out over the crowd of people. They want to hear from Jesus and have sacrificed to be there. Jesus considers this and tells the disciples to feed the people. Mary Magdalene points out that they only have a few loaves of bread and two fish. Jesus takes the baskets and proclaims to the heavens and the people, "Blessed is the Lord God, King of the Universe who brings forth bread from the earth."

ZaraoAs the day neared its end, the Twelve came to Jesus and said, “Dismiss the crowd so they can go to the surrounding villages and countryside for lodging and provisions. For we are in a desolate place here.” But Jesus told them, “You give them something to eat.” “We have only five loaves of bread and two fish,” they answered, “unless we go and buy food for all these people.” (There were about five thousand men.) He told His disciples, “Have them sit down in groups of about fifty each.” They did so, and everyone was seated.
